Tamiya 1/35 Tiger Tank Early VersionThis German Tiger I tank model was built from a Tamiya 35227 kit in January, 2014. Although the instruction told me to paint as a African Corps Pz, I still decided to add red-green camoflage, which was roughly painted by my brush. Therefore, at the end I had to use some Tamiya XF-1 enamel to cover those colors. As for my standard, it was not perfect enough.

Model Background Information

Development of the Tiger I was started in 1937 by the Henschel company. Mass production began in 1942, with an eventual total of 1,354 vehicles manufactured. The tank first saw combat in the fighting for Leningrad, and Tigers were at the forefront of battles from Tunisia to Kursk. Although production was discontinued in the summer of 1944, the Tiger I continued to see action until the end of the war.
This was the first German heavy tank in WWII and proved itself to be extremely formidable against the Allied forces, composed primarily of M4 Sherman and T-34.
